Sweet pastries make a delicious breakfast, a fun treat for the kids or are ideal for family picnics. My boys love any type of pastry, and I do too – especially straight from the oven! These apricot pinwheels are easy to make, and really tasty.

Ingredients for Apricot Pin wheels

      • the zest & juice of 1 orange
      • 210g of dried mixed fruits
      • 385g puff pastry (It’s fine to use ready-rolled)
      • 3 tbsp Cottage Delight Apricot jam
      • 210g marzipan

Method : How to make Apricot Pin Wheels

  1. Preheat the oven to 200C/Gas 6/fan oven 180C.
  2. Squeeze out the juice from your orange into a small bowl and add the dried mixed fruit, then mix together.
  3. Roll out the pastry sheet to approximately 30cm x 25cm, spread the Apricot jam over the pastry. Roll out the marzipan to the same size and place on top of the pastry sheet.
  4. Scatter the mixed fruit over the 2 sheets and tightly roll long ways like a Swiss roll. Place in the fridge for 20 minutes. Remove from the fridge and slice into 2cm thick sections.
  5. Place each section onto a pre-lined baking tray and put them into the oven for 7-10 minutes.
  6. Remove the pastries from the oven and allow them to cool on a wire rack.
  7. Enjoy!
